∆ Tech in the News
To Handle Bank Runs - Top U.S. banking regulator, Michael Hsu (acting Comptroller of the Currency) has called for new liquidity rules to help lenders respond to SVB-like runs by depositors.
Meta’s AI Ambitions - Zuck declares that Meta’s long-term goal is to build and open-source AGI. Meta also plans to fuse its Fundamental AI and GenAI Research teams to bring AI closer to human-like intelligence.
AI Meets Academia - Arizona State University partners with OpenAI, incorporating AI into their educational and organizational processes and becoming the first university to have this kind of partnership.
Go Figure! - BMW will deploy robotics startup Figure’s humanoid robots in its South Carolina factory’s body shop, sheet metal facility, and warehouse.
Reddit IPO - Reddit seeks to launch its IPO, selling 10% of its shares in March - the first IPO by a major social media company since Pinterest in 2019.

˚The Hottest Thing in Tech this Week
AI and Web3… Meet Smartphones
If 2023 was the year GenAI exploded into mainstream awareness, 2024 could be the year it becomes part of our lives, via that most ubiquitous device, the phone. Samsung’s latest flagship Galaxy S24 Android phones feature “Galaxy AI” tools like instant phone call translation, new Google search, and advanced image and video-editing features. Having just lost the top phone seller spot to Apple, Samsung seems to be betting on AI to help them make up ground. Of note also that Google and Samsung appear to becoming even closer collaborators thanks to Google’s investment in its multimodular Gemini Nano AI model that runs natively on devices. This makes some sense since Samsung sells far more Android phones than Google. The Pixel 8 Pro also featured AI tools late last year, but the features on offer were less exciting than those Samsung just revealed.
The iPhone 16 is due in September, giving the Android field a window to make the most of this lead before we see what Apple’s “millions of dollars a day” spend on AI yields. We got hints when Apple claimed their Ajax-GPT model outdoes ChatGPT-3.5, or when it published a ML framework to build models that run well on Apple, or news it is working to optimize the ability to run LLMs on phones. We also got news of plans for an improved Siri with AI-focused features.
While it’s not a phone itself, the Rabbit R1 was CES 2024’s surprise hit, the gadget connects to your phone’s apps and accounts and you verbally give it tasks to complete. Rabbit may well be obsolete once the phones can do this themselves, but it hints at how popular an AI agent for smartphones will be. Rabbit also just partnered with Google challenger Perplexity AI.
In other mobile news, Vodafone just inked a $1.5B deal with Microsoft to enhance its services with genAI, cloud, and IoT technologies, showing how the worlds of AI, industry and mobile tech are further blurring together. Finally, this week Solana Mobile saw 30,000 preorders in the first 30 hours for its second-gen phone, “Chapter 2”. This Web3-ready phone will likely soon incorporate AI features as there is significant interest in AI amongst Solana founders and a lot of AI activity on the blockchain already.
